Man guilty of killing girlfriend, her daughter

Published 10:38 am Friday, September 30, 2016

MINNEAPOLIS — A jury has convicted a Minneapolis man of first-degree murder for shooting his girlfriend and her daughter to death.

The Hennepin County jury took only a couple of hours to convict Gonzalo Galvan late Tuesday afternoon. The 51-year-old will automatically be sentenced to life in prison at his Oct. 6 hearing.

Galvan called 911 last September to report that he had shot 48-year-old Eugenia Tallman and her 15-year-old daughter, Victoria Alvarez. The couple’s seven-year-old son was unharmed but witnessed the shooting.
